Key Challenges in Custom AI Chatbot Implementation

Successful integration of custom AI chatbots into business operations involves overcoming several challenges. Firstly, there’s the challenge of data privacy and security. Companies must ensure that their chatbots comply with regulations like GDPR to protect user data. Another critical issue is the potential bias in AI, where the chatbot might display prejudiced behavior if the training data is skewed. Moreover, businesses face the technical challenge of integrating chatbots with existing systems and databases. Ensuring that the AI can understand and process various languages and dialects can also be a significant hurdle, emphasizing the need for sophisticated natural language processing capabilities.

Controversies Surrounding Custom AI Chatbots

One controversy involves the displacement of human workers, as chatbots can potentially take over jobs, particularly in customer service roles. There’s also the ethical concern regarding the manipulation of conversations and the extent to which AI should be involved in personal and sensitive topics. The transparency of AI decision-making processes is another contentious issue, as it can sometimes be unclear how a chatbot arrives at a particular response or action.

Advantages and Disadvantages of Custom AI Chatbots

The advantages of implementing custom AI chatbots include enhanced customer service capabilities, with 24/7 availability leading to higher customer satisfaction and engagement. They also offer scalability, allowing businesses to handle large volumes of inquiries without additional human resources. Another benefit is the ability to gather and analyze customer data to improve service and personalize customer experiences.

On the other hand, the disadvantages include the cost and complexity of development. Designing a chatbot that can truly understand and respond appropriately to all user queries requires significant investment. There’s also the possibility of technical issues such as errors or outages, which can negatively affect the customer experience. Additionally, there can be a lack of human empathy and understanding, which is sometimes necessary for complex customer service issues.
